Ohio Women's Basketball Takes Down IUPUI, 70-64

ATHENS, Ohio – The Ohio women's basketball team (6-2, 0-0 MAC) defeated IUPUI (4-4, 0-0 Horizon), 70-64, on Saturday afternoon at the Convocation Center.

Junior guard Cece Hooks (Dayton, Ohio) led the way with her first double-double of the season after posting 25 points and 10 rebounds. Hooks was 7-of-13 from the field and knocked down the two three-pointers she shot. Hooks added six assists, three steals and two blocks in 38 minutes on the floor. She got to the line 13 times and made nine free throws.

Junior forward Gabby Burris (Baltimore, Ohio) had 17 points on 7-of-14 shooting and made three from deep. Burris was one rebound short of a double-double with nine rebounds in 37 minutes of play.

Senior guard Amani Burke (Columbus, Ohio) produced nine points while going a perfect 6-of-6 from the free throw line. Redshirt sophomore guard Erica Johnson (Mansfield, Ohio) had seven points while redshirt sophomore guard Caitlyn Kroll (Bridgeport, Ohio) recorded four points. Freshman guard Peyton Guice (Westerville, Ohio) scored her first basket as a Bobcat and had three points while redshirt junior guard Katie Barker (Cary, Ill.) hit one three-pointer.

"I thought defensively we were solid," head coach Bob Boldon said. "Defensively against a team like this, I thought we did a pretty good job and I was happy with that end of the floor. The score is one thing, but the number of shots they made up against the clock is another. They made some tough shots up against the clock."

Overall, Ohio was 23-of-57 (40.4 percent) from the field and 8-of-21 (38.1 percent) from behind the three-point line. Ohio was 16-of-21 from the free throw line. The Bobcats held IUPUI to 26-of-65 shooting (40.0 percent) and 6-of-26 (23.1 percent) from behind the three-point line. IUPUI got to the line just seven times and made six.

"Everyone who came off the bench did some good things for us," Burris said. "It's a lot of pressure, especially playing a team like that. They stepped up and did their role."

The Jaguars outrebounded Ohio, 43-35. Ohio was led on the boards by Hooks (10) and Burris (9). Kroll and sophomore forward Deesh Beck (Grand Rapids, Mich.) had three boards each while Barker and Johnson each pulled in two.

The Bobcats forced 16 turnovers and recorded 11 steals in the victory. Johnson led the way with four steals while Hooks had three. Ohio had 14 points off turnovers in the win and 15 fast break points.

Ohio took a 18-17 lead into the first break. OU was 7-of-19 (36.8 percent) from the floor and hit four from deep. Hooks had five with one three-pointer while Johnson and Burke each hit a three. The Bobcats took the lead on a Johnson three with two seconds left in the quarter.

The Bobcats outscored IUPUI 19-12 in the second quarter to take a 37-29 advantage into the half. OU shot 7-of-15 (46.7 percent) from the field and made two three-pointers. Hooks had 10 points in the frame while Burris posted five and Johnson scored four. Ohio forced a IUPUI timeout at 28-21 with 5:57 left in the quarter on a steal and fast break layup from Johnson. An and-one layup from Hooks put Ohio up 10 at 31-21. Hooks and Burris went back-to-back from deep to end the frame.

Ohio pushed the lead to 54-45 after three quarters. OU had 10 points in the paint in the third frame with Hooks scoring six. The Bobcats were 5-of-11 (45.5 percent) from the field and 7-of-8 (87.5 percent) from the charity stripe in the quarter.

IUPUI outscored OU 19-16 in the final frame. Burris hit two from deep and had eight points overall while Hooks and Burke each had four points. Ohio was 4-of-12 in the frame (33.3 percent) and was 2-of-4 (50.0 percent) from behind the arc. IUPUI held Ohio without a field goal in the last 3:07 of the game, but Burke made four free throws in that time span to seal the game for Ohio.
